Day 01

Marrakech – High Atlas Mountains – Ait Benhaddou – Ouarzazate – Dades Valley

Departing on this 3 day desert trip from Marrakech to Fes, you cross the Tizi n'Tichka High Atlas Mountains pass to the village of Ait Benhaddou for a guided tour of the kasbah. It is listed under UNESCO World Heritage, a spectacular fortified village (ksar). Afterwards, we continue toward the Dades Valley via the desert gateway city of Ouarzazate — the "Moroccan Hollywood" — and the palm grove of Skoura.

Day 02

Dades Valley – Todra Gorge – Erfoud – Merzouga – Erg Chebbi

Visit the Dades Valley and Tinerhir to see the Todra Gorges, the highest gorge in Morocco — just 20 meters wide and over 300 meters high — with roughly 20 minutes of walking to take it in. Todra Gorge is a canyon in the eastern High Atlas Mountains, well known for rock climbing in Morocco. From there, continue to the edge of the dunes at Merzouga, where you'll ride camels across the Erg Chebbi dunes on a camel trek with a camel guide, and sleep in a nomadic tent at the desert camp. Enjoy an overnight stay under the stars, with real desert atmosphere and music.

Day 03

Merzouga – Ziz Valley – Cedar Forest – Ifrane – Fes

Wake early to see the sunrise and ride camel back to the hotel or guest house for breakfast and a shower. Next, we keep driving via the Ziz Valley or Gorges and the cedar forest where Barbary macaques live — an interesting route with a stop for lunch in Midelt. Drop-off at your accommodation, riad or hotel, in Fes, founded by Moulay Idriss I in 789 and a World Heritage Site.
